Service Desk Co-Ordinator/Administrator

Monday - Friday 8.30 to 5pm

Salary : £30,000.

Responsibilities:
  • Manage and oversee the daily operations of the Service Desk, ensuring efficient and effective resolution of IT support requests.
  • Act as the main point of contact for all incoming support tickets, phone calls, and emails from users and customers.
  • Prioritize and assign support tickets to the appropriate technical support teams based on urgency and complexity.
  • Monitor and track support tickets to ensure timely resolution and adherence to service level agreements (SLAs).
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ation of support processes, standard operating procedures, and knowledge base articles.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to address systemic issues, enhance service desk procedures, and implement process improvements.
  • Attend regular training sessions to improve technology skills and promote self-service options for common issues.
  • Proactively identify trends and recurring issues to develop long-term solutions and prevent future incidents.
  • Continuously strive to improve customer satisfaction by delivering exceptional service and ensuring positive customer experiences.
  • Prepare and present reports on service desk performance, metrics, and customer feedback to management.
Requirements:
  • Proven experience in a service desk or help desk
  • Strong knowledge of IT systems, hardware, and software
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to communicate information clearly and effectively to non-technical users.
  • Outstanding problem-solving skills and the ability to handle mult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ment.
  • Customer-focused approach with a commitment to delivering exceptional service.
  • You have demonstrated the 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ams to resolve issues and improve processes.
  • Experience with in the engineering sector or similar.
